What affects the price

When you start planning a fireplace installation, the final bill depends on a few major factors. Choosing between a simple electric unit, a gas insert, or a full wood-burning masonry build creates the biggest difference in cost. You also have to consider the existing setup of your home; running new gas lines or venting through a roof will naturally add labor hours compared to a straightforward swap. Finishing materials like custom stonework or mantel pieces also shift the total.

About this service

Installing a fireplace involves more than just the appliance; it includes venting, gas hookups, and framing. If your home already has a fireplace, replacing it is often cheaper than adding one where none existed before. The final bill is driven by the type of fuel source and the finish work around the hearth.

Can I install a fireplace myself in Cary?

While some basic electric units might be DIY-friendly, most gas or wood-burning fireplaces require professional installation. This ensures safety, proper ventilation, and compliance with Cary's building codes. Improper installation can lead to serious hazards. Do fireplaces need to be professionally installed?

For safety and proper functionality, most fireplaces, especially gas and wood-burning models, absolutely need professional installation. Licensed pros ensure correct ventilation, gas line connections, and adherence to building codes, which is crucial for preventing fires and carbon monoxide issues.
